Candace Huffman, age 55 of Hamilton, passed away on Sunday, October 10, 2021. Candace was born in Hamilton, Ohio on August 26, 1966 to Mike and the late Sharon (Plowman) Daniels. Known to many as Candy, she graduated from Hamilton High School and later studied business and management. She was employed with Miami Valley International, which was acquired by Rush Trucking. Candy enjoyed hosting pool parties in the summer, attending festivals in the fall, and being a mom all year round. Using recipes that have been handed down through the generations, she will be remembered for her wonderful cooking. Above all, Candy loved spending time with her family, especially her grandchildren.
Candy will be dearly missed by her husband, Don Huffman; her children, Kristopher Swain, Amber Swain, Madison Huffman, and Erin Huffman; her grandchildren, Brooklyn, E'mmoni, Kloe, Lilly, Frankie, and Hannah; her father, Mike Daniels; her sisters, Amy (Ronald) Tipton and Michelle (Bobby) Vaugh; as well as many nieces, nephews, extended family members and close friends. Candy was preceded in death by her mother, Sharon Daniels and her grandson, Jayden.
Graveside Services will be held at Rose Hill Burial Park, 2421 Princeton Road, Hamilton, Ohio, on Saturday, October 16, 2021 at 11:00 AM.
